Balance tip for women especially: practice your balance in all the shoes you wear. When we think of balance exercises we usually want to be barefoot or wearing runners, but what about that summer wedding or graduation celebration? We can find ourselves in outdoor/indoor venues with lots of different surfaces, children darting around, etc. Safety first of course - make sure you have something sturdy to grab when you practice. First, good news: you don't have to become a triathlete to get these effects. The rule of thumb is you want to get three to four times a week exercise, minimum 30 minutes an exercise session, and you want to get aerobic exercise in. That is, get your heart rate up. And the good news is, you don't have to go to the gym to get a very expensive gym membership. Add an extra walk around the block in your power walk. You see stairs -- take stairs. And power-vacuuming can be as good as the aerobics class that you were going to take at the gym.
